I have personal experience with Weil corporate. While I think it is a typical sweatshop big law firm in terms of hours, I found the culture to be extremely supportive. I had some personal, serious illness related issues and they were more than understanding and generous. I think the atmosphere is great and the partners are smart. The work is complex and varied. I would recommend but only if you are ready to undertake biglaw hours.
